For example, Bermuda grass seeds planted in mid-spring under the perfect conditions will take less than a full week to germinate. WebFeb 26, 2024 · Step 1: Preparing the Soil. Remove all existing vegetation, rocks, and debris from the area where you plan to apply Bermuda grass. Test the soil pH and make any necessary adjustments to ensure it is between 6.0 and 7.0, which is optimal for Bermuda grass growth. WebStep 4: Water the Bermuda grass seeds. After planting the seeds, water your yard thoroughly to keep the soil moist. You will then want to water the yard daily as well. Even though Bermuda grass is drought-tolerant, a lot of water is required initially for the seeds to germinate. For the first three to four weeks, keep the soil moist. WebSep 7, 2024 · The germination time for Bermuda grass seed depends heavily on soil temperatures. As a warm-weather-loving plant, Bermuda grass does best when planted in late spring or early summer. It can be planted in the fall, but precautions should be taken to keep the seed from dying before it can establish itself.

WebMar 8, 2024 · Best Bermuda grass varieties to plant in Georgia. Bermuda grass is available in non-hybrid and hybrid varieties. Hybrid types typically produce higher yields but are propagated from sprigs and stolons rather than seeds. That said, if you grow Bermuda grass seeds, high-quality cultivars are also available.
